    What night is the big dance in the lobby at the Grand Floridian Buffett

    Hi, Tanya! Welcome to the Disney Parks Moms Panel and thanks so much for stopping by with your question!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a does host a Princess Promenade in its lobby, featuring Cinderella and Prince Charming, that all guests are welcome to attend. My younger daughter participated in it last year and it was such a sweet moment for all! The promenade is not an official event, so its schedule does tend to change. I spoke with the resort's Front Desk a few weeks ago and found that it was scheduled at 3:45 p.m. every day except Tuesdays and Thursdays. As I mentioned, this is subject to change, so check with the front desk of any Disney Resort Hotel and they will be able to get that week's updated schedule for you.

    You mentioned the dinner at 1900 Park Fare; are you by chance going to Cinderella's Happily Ever After Dinner? This is such a regal affair and I do hope that you are able to experience it! It is honestly my older daughter's favorite character meal, made so by the antics of the stepsisters! Anastasia and Drizella Tremaine frequently pop in to delight guests with their loveliness (okay, I admit, my friend Anastasia insists that I always mention their loveliness). You may also find Cinderella, Prince Charming, Lady Tremaine, and Fairy Godmother in attendance. The Fairy Godmother definitely works some spells with her magic wand when it comes to that buffet! There are so many delicious options! Be sure to try a cup of the strawberry soup!
